Greek Architectures of Data Processing

Greeks are famous from many things. But first of the thing that comes in the mind when we hear “Greek” is the “Greek Architecture” and “Greek Alphabets” (i.e alpha beta gamma).

Greek Architecture is the flowering of geometry

This about what will happen when we merge Greek alphabets to Greek architecture? No we do not get new buildings and physical architecture but we get state of the art Data Processing Architecture.

Following are the three popular Data processing architecure for big and small data on cloud. These cover various scenarios for both batch, realtime, small and big data. The links take to the dedicated blog for each architecture

Lambda Architecture:

Based on the concept of Batch Layer, Speed Layer and Serving Layer

Kappa Architecture:

Based on the concept of processing data in Speed Layer only

Delta Architecture:

Based on the plan of merging the batch and speed layer